6
Tooth decay also known as cavity, is damage
caused to your enamel, or tooths surface.
7
The damage is caused when plaque builds up on
your teeth produces harmful acid.
8
Here are the signs you may have tooth decay.
9
You have a tooth ache
10
An ongoing pain or ache in your teeth is a common
sign of tooth decay.
11
The pain and pressure may also be present when
you chew food.
12
The pain will originate in your tooth but will
cause discomfort in or around your whole mouth.
13
Sensitivity in your teeth
14
Sensitivity is another sign of tooth decay.
15
Most commonly, your teeth will experience
sensitivity to temperature.
16
This may leave you with a sharp pain when you eat
something hot or drink something cold.
17
This sensitivity will be present at the beginning
of tooth decay.
18
Stains on your teeth
19
The stain will start as a white spot on the
surface of your tooth.
20
The stain will become darker when the tooth decay
goes untreated or advances.
21
If left untreated, the stain will turn black or
brown.
22
A hole or pit in your tooth
23
The stain will also leave a hole or pit in the
affected tooth.
24
Other times, the hole will develop in between
your teeth or in the crevices of your tooth.
